Output 39928e71d7b9f1cc60ed3254ba975d4e6b7863f18f8e6c7a9c42e991ae91a110:143

value
269022
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ea392b4e4d24ec1d02e0cc84af26cb021e4e2e60 OP_EQUAL
address
3P3UXcdksp4ViLaJQoSZ1CQUnJ3J2QA4U5
transaction
39928e71d7b9f1cc60ed3254ba975d4e6b7863f18f8e6c7a9c42e991ae91a110
confirmations
124538
spent
true